12 Beekman Pl Apt 8D
Listing Notes
Embrace Beekman Place serenity and charm in this recently renovated expansive one-bedroom, one-bathroom featuring generous proportions, excellent closet space and oversized windows in a coveted postwar white-glove co-op. Inside this sun-kissed home, you'll enjoy an ideal layout for comfortable living and lively entertaining filled with tall ceilings, parquet wood floors and wide expanses of south-facing windows. The entry opens to an extra-large foyer perfect as a dining area or home office space flanked by three large closets. Ahead, stretch out and relax in the spacious and bright living room lined with oversized windows and built-in shelving. The newly renovated windowed kitchen boasts abundant cabinet space and full-sized appliances, including a gas range, dishwasher, and built-in microwave. Head to the sprawling bedroom to find a wide reach-in closet and plenty of room for a king-size bed, additional furnishings, a sitting area, and even a home office or fitness space. The updated adjacent bathroom's large tub/shower, vanity, medicine cabinet and shelving are surrounded by white tile. Move right into this pin-drop quiet rear-facing unit. 12 Beekman Place is a handsome full-service cooperative where residents enjoy 24-hour doorman service, an on-site resident manager and porters, an on-site parking garage accessible from within the building (subject to availability), storage (subject to availability), a bike room, laundry, updated common areas and a new garden patio. Pets, pieds- -terre and 65% financing are permitted with board approval. Located in the heart of Turtle Bay, this fine home offers the perfect blend of Beekman Place serenity and outstanding accessibility to Midtown attractions. The United Nations, Dag Hammarskjold Plaza, Grand Central Terminal, and world-class shopping, dining and nightlife venues are all within easy reach, including Whole Foods and the Trader Joe's Bridgemarket location. Enjoy waterfront outdoor space along the East River at 51st Street, or take in the dazzling waterfall at hidden gem Greenacre Park. Transportation is effortless with 6, E and M trains within five blocks; 4/5/6, S, 7 and Metro-North trains at Grand Central Terminal; plus, easy access to the CitiBikes, Midtown Tunnel and 59th Street Bridge.
